So there's a limit on democracies declaring wars until world tension gets high enough. And faction members inherit the limits of their faction leaders. But democratic factions can avoid the limits pretty much entirely by finding a communist or fascist country to pump up WT then join the Democrat faction and let the democratic faction declare war. See Prussian prince's multiplayer stream where communist France did this. There needs to be a bad boy or something that prevents communist or fascist countries that have contributed to raising world tension from joining democratic factions.

Tinkle posted:Can someone give a breakdown of differences in adding artillery as a support battalion and just adding it to the front line. Adding them to the frontline just seems flat out better at the cost of more supplies. I have to imagine having artillery in support ALWAYS gives the bonuses as opposed of having them on the front line and finding space to operate in the "front width"? Support brigades can't slow down their division. So armor or mech divisions should have support art as opposed to line art. Though spg line divisions are fine. There are also doctrines that improve line art or support art.

TheDemon posted:Naval bombers on carriers are given no mission by default and if they do not have a mission, will always participate in their carrier's combats. In addition, during combat they can fly three times a day whereas land based naval bombers can fly once. So they are the equivalent of 100% coverage, 100% chance to find ships, 300% sortie numbers, ignores air superiority. Jesus, I guess that kinda makes sense given their obscenely priced airfields.
